Title: Dampak Pandemi Covid-19 terhadap Ekonomi Masyarakat di Kawasan Wisata Cidahu, Kabupaten Sukabumi, Jawa Barat

Abstract: Pandemi Covid-19 muncul pada akhir tahun 2019, dengan penyebaran virus yang cepat dan berdampak signifikan di berbagai sektor, salah satunya pariwisata. Kunjungan wisatawan menurun drastis, seperti yang terjadi di kawasan wisata Desa Cidahu, Sukabumi, Jawa Barat yang berbatasan dengan TNGHS. Penelitian ini bertujuan mengidentifikasi persepsi masyarakat mengenai dampak pandemi Covid 19 terhadap perekonomian masyarakat dan strategi mitigasi dalam menghadapi pandemi dari aspek ekonomi. Melalui survei kuesioner rumah tangga, wawancara, observasi lapang, dan studi literatur dengan analisis kuantitatif dan kualitatif, diketahui bahwa pandemi Covid-19 berdampak pada perekonomian masyarakat. Masyarakat mengalami penurunan pendapatan dan mengurangi konsumsi rumah tangga sebagai upaya pertahanan. Meski demikian, masyarakat tidak termotivasi mencari pekerjaan lain, tetapi cenderung mengembangkan dan berinovasi pada bidang pekerjaan yang sudah ditekuni. Strategi mitigasi yang bisa dilakukan oleh masyarakat untuk menghadapi situasi pandemi di antaranya mengoptimalkan sumberdaya, menambah objek wisata minat khusus, mencari alternatif pekerjaan, membuat inovasi pengelolaan wisata. Untuk mewujudkan strategi mitigasi tersebut, diperlukan peningkatkan kapasitas SDM bagi pengelola dan masyarakat sekitar.
The Covid-19 pandemic emerged at the end of 2019, with the rapid spread of the virus causing a significant impact on various sectors; one was the tourism. Tourist visits have decreased drastically as happened in the tourist area of Cidahu Village, Sukabumi, West Java, which is adjacent to the TNGHS. This study aimed to identify public perceptions regarding the impact of the Covid-19 pandemic on the community's economy and mitigation strategies in dealing with a pandemic from an economic perspective. Through household questionnaire surveys, interviews, field observations, and literature studies with quantitative and qualitative analysis, the Covid-19 pandemic had impacted the people's economy. The community experienced a decrease in income and reduced household consumption as a means of defense. Even so, people are not motivated to look for other jobs but tend to develop and innovate in the fields of work that have been occupied. Mitigation strategies that can be carried out by the community to deal with a pandemic situation are optimizing existing resources, adding special interest tourist objects, finding alternative jobs, and innovating tourism management. It is necessary to improve the human resources capacity for managers and the surrounding community to realize the strategies.
